Timeline
15 December 2025
Written question
To ask the Secretary of State for Transport, if she will make an assessment of the potential merits of mandating that electric bike rental firms ensure that all riders of rented electric bikes wear helmets.
Source: Commons
19 December 2025
Answer
The Government agrees that cyclists should wear helmets whenever possible to help reduce the risk of sustaining a head injury. We are implementing licensing for shared cycle schemes and will consult in depth on this. Consultation will include consideratio...
